Hey. So, I'm thirteen, about 5 feet and I think like 97 pounds. I REALLY want to lose some weight. I try going on diets, but it never works, and I have like an inability to fast, or not eat.

I need help, how can I lose weight in a living area where I have little to no room to exercise? I need tips on what I can eat, that isnt gross.


Thanks :]

mekago5 answered Friday March 2 2007, 3:59 pm:
Actually, your weight sounds perfect for someone of your height. If you go to this webpage...

[Link](Mouse over link to see full location)

... and enter your height and weight, it will tell you if you are overweight, underweight, or just right. You are actually closer to the underweight area.

However, if you feel like you just want to tone up then you should look up some exercises that you can do at home. Weight training, crunches, and walking are always good. There are also exercise balls that you can get and they have tons of things you can do with them and you don't need much room.

Good Luck!
